In the "El Correo español" (Madrid) June 16, 1899, página 3, it was reported that the three burglars - a married couple and their son - would be sentenced tomorrow, for the burglary they committed on June 6, 1898.
In the "La Correspondencia de España" (Madrid) June 17, 1899, issue n.º 15.110, página 3, it was reported that the two new Guitars, one Bandurria, a magnificent ornate Laud, Guitar Picks, sixteen pairs of Castanets, five pairs of Castanets were valued at 587 pesetas. The whole amount of goods stolen drew these prison sentences. The women involved got the longest sentence for being a repeat offender of the law.
